Beulah

/ˈbjuːlə/ proper noun

A female given name used in English-speaking cultures, derived from Hebrew meaning 'married' or 'possessed.'

From Hebrew 'beulah,' appearing in the Biblical book of Isaiah to describe the land of Israel. Adopted as a given name by English speakers, particularly in Christian communities.
